    The city's nickname, "the Climate Capital of Colorado", derives from the combination of unique geography and 5,300-foot (1,600 m) elevation protecting the city from harsh weather conditions. The average daily high temperature in January is 14 °F (7.8 °C) warmer in Cañon City than in Grand Junction , even though the elevation of Cañon City ...

    The Royal Gorge is a canyon of the Arkansas River located west of Cañon City, Colorado. The canyon begins at the mouth of Grape Creek, about 2 mi (3.2 km) west of central Cañon City, and continues in a west-northwesterly direction for approximately 6 mi (9.7 km) until ending near U.S. Route 50.     Scenic. Skyline Drive is a scenic roadway in Cañon City, Colorado. It was built by inmate labor in 1905. [1] The road starts from U.S. Highway 50 and gradually inclines up the side of a ridge.
